Frequently Asked Questions

8th Grade AP English Language is an advanced course that focuses on rhetorical analysis, argumentation, and writing skills at a college-preparatory level. Unlike standard English classes, AP English Language emphasizes analyzing how authors construct arguments and persuade audiences through language choices, rather than primarily focusing on literature interpretation. Students learn to identify rhetorical strategies, evaluate evidence, and develop their own persuasive writing—skills that prepare them for the AP English Language and Composition exam in high school.

Many 8th graders struggle with identifying and analyzing rhetorical devices—understanding not just what an author uses, but why and how it affects the reader. Another frequent challenge is writing persuasive essays with strong thesis statements and well-developed arguments supported by textual evidence. Additionally, students often find it difficult to manage timed writing sections, where they must quickly analyze passages and construct coherent responses under pressure. A tutor can help break down these skills into manageable steps and build confidence through targeted practice.

Tutors focus on the specific skills that matter in AP English Language: crafting clear thesis statements, organizing arguments logically, selecting and analyzing evidence, and varying sentence structure for rhetorical effect. Rather than just marking errors, a tutor works with your student to understand why certain writing choices are more effective than others. They'll provide feedback on drafts, model strong writing, and guide your student through the revision process. This personalized approach helps students internalize writing principles and apply them independently in future assignments.
